Moelis Private Capital Advisory ("PCA") is a global business that provides strategic advisory and distribution to private fund sponsors and institutional investors, including primary fundraising, tailored capital raise solutions, and secondary market advisory. Combined with the Firm's leading financial sponsor franchise, sector expertise and M&A capabilities, PCA delivers a range of strategic, customized solutions to clients across a wide range of strategies, including buyout, growth, real assets, special situations and sector specific strategies.
The Secondary Advisory team at Moelis & Company is a global team focused on advising institutional investors and financial sponsors on a wide range of strategic liquidity solutions across the private capital universe. Within this platform, the LP-led practice advises limited partners — including pension plans, endowments and foundations, sovereign wealth funds, insurance companies, family offices, asset managers, and funds-of-funds — on the sale and restructuring of their private markets portfolios and individual fund interests. The team works closely with industry and product groups across Moelis to provide relevant market insight, portfolio valuation and structuring advice, and best-in-class execution to clients. As a member of the team, successful candidates will be responsible for providing advisory, structuring, and execution services to institutional investors seeking liquidity across their private capital holdings.
Position Description:
The Associate position at Moelis offers exposure to all aspects of the LP-led secondary market, including single-fund and multi-fund LP portfolio sales, structured and preferred equity solutions, deferred and staggered-closing structures, NAV-based financings, and other liquidity and portfolio-management solutions for institutional investors. The Associate will work closely with professionals throughout the firm to deliver high quality advice to LP clients as they actively manage and rebalance their private markets programs.
Responsibilities:
- Perform portfolio-, fund-, and underlying company-level due diligence and valuation analysis across diversified LP portfolios; prepare marketing materials (portfolio overviews, teasers, data books, etc.) and other transaction-related documentation
- Financial analysis and modeling, including LP portfolio valuations, cash flow and NAV projections, pricing analyses, LBOs, and waterfalls
- Assist in managing buy-side investor outreach and due diligence (e.g., data room management, GP reference calls, investor Q&A)
- Contribute to preparing responses to due diligence requests from potential secondary buyers, and coordinate information flow between selling LPs and prospective purchasers
- Communicate and collaborate regularly with Moelis' industry and financial sponsor coverage team members
- Maintain databases of secondary market transactions, LP portfolio pricing benchmarks, buy-side investors (profiles, strategies, investment preferences), and broader market data to support marketing materials and client advice
- Communicate regularly with buy-side investors (dedicated secondary funds, family offices, SWFs, insurance firms, funds-of-funds, asset managers, etc.)
- Conduct secondary market research, including tracking LP portfolio pricing, deal volumes, and liquidity trends across the alternatives industry
- Conduct ad hoc industry research
